Why Brushing Too Hard Happens—Often Without Realizing

🧠 It’s a Psychological Habit

Many users equate “clean” with “force,” especially when dealing with plaque or coffee stains. This mental association can make brushing become a form of scrubbing rather than gentle cleaning—particularly when using a manual toothbrush.

🪥 Lack of Technique Awareness

Most people were never formally taught how to brush properly. Without clear guidance, it’s easy to assume more effort equals better results. People may apply the same pressure as they do when cleaning other surfaces, like countertops or dishes.

⚠️ No Feedback from Manual Brushes

With traditional toothbrushes, there’s no way to tell if you’re brushing too hard unless you notice pain or gum recession later. Many people never adjust their technique because they lack real-time feedback.

 

The Hidden Damage of Overbrushing

Worn Enamel

Excessive pressure can gradually erode enamel—the protective outer layer of your teeth—making them more vulnerable to decay and sensitivity.

Receding Gums

Aggressive brushing can cause your gums to recede, exposing the tooth’s roots and increasing the risk of infections and tooth loss.

Tooth Sensitivity

Worn enamel and exposed dentin can lead to sharp pain when eating or drinking hot, cold, or sweet foods.

 

How to Know If You’re Brushing Too Hard

 • Your toothbrush bristles fray quickly (within 1–2 months).
 • You notice receding gums or increased tooth sensitivity.
 • Your dentist mentions signs of abrasion or gum damage.
 • You tend to “scrub” your teeth rather than gently sweep.

Tips for Gentler Brushing

 • Use a soft-bristled toothbrush (BrushO’s brush heads are designed with sensitive enamel in mind).
 • Hold your brush with just three fingers instead of a full grip.
 • Let the toothbrush do the work—especially if it’s electric.
 • Use circular motions rather than back-and-forth scrubbing.
